    AI Startups get a policy shock with MeitY advisory

    An AI advisory issued by MeitY shook every GenAI start-up founder in the last month. A mix of vague clauses and terms constituting the text raises more questions than it answers. Inconsistent communication from MeitY to clarify the legalese did not help matters either.

    These AI regulations highlight the need to have an open dialogue between developers, startups and policy makers. Anwesha Sen, project manager at Anthill Inside, draws on community insights to explain the problems with the recent AI advisory.

    When it comes to crypto, don’t be a hero

    “Avoid being a maverick when dealing with highly sensitive, personally Identifiable Information (PII)”. Abhay Rana (captn3m0) explains why you probably shouldn’t roll out your own crypto (unless it’s peer reviewed).

    Abhay recommends sticking to mature and well-tested technologies like TLS, bcrypt and HMAC which are built by cryptography experts, peer-reviewed and only then established as industry standard. He also shares security horror stories and valuable lessons learnt while building Razorpay.

    Scaling up: How Freshdesk went from 7K rpm to 700k rpm by choosing shell architecture

    Shell architecture diagram
    Raadhika Srinivasan (Senior Software Engineer at Freshworks) explains how choosing shell architecture helped Freshdesk scale from serving a few thousand requests per minute to a whopping 7,00,000 requests per minute.

    Re-architecting at the right time eliminated a whole class of recurring availability issues and positioned Freshdesk for substantial growth. Is shell architecture right for your organization? Raadhikaa lays down the pros and cons to help you decide.

    Raising funds for early stage Robotics startups


    Fundraising for a deep tech start-up, which might not have any significant MRR in the nascent stages, is crucial. Pranav, co-founder at Accio, delves into getting the right investors who understand your niche and will help your startup gain sufficient leverage. Having a focused business strategy and having the right answers while pitching is key — a major factor for the robotics startup in raising a cumulative ₹18.6 Cr pre-seed.

    Software Delivery: Prioritizing and optimizing for impact


    An engineering-led approach for prioritizing what to build is to say “show me the data”; what is the potential impact of building out a certain feature?
    The answer to this question starts an iterative, data-driven process, which gives directional clues for course correction, while also giving a better definition of the outcome for both leaders and engineers. Gaurav Lochan, Head of Engineering at PhonePe, shares his pragmatic approach on prioritization to deliver highly impactful software.
